Prof. Dr. Ramkrishna Sastri

Prof. Dr. Ramkrishna Sastri has been serving as an organizer for the past 50 years in several roles starting from that of a Teacher, President and guide for the next generation. He is the Founder & Chairman of Indian Institute of Oriental Heritage (IIOH).

His aim is to promote the Indian culture and heritage from the very begining. His target was to promote the value-oriented lessons to proceed forward and achieving the Global Peace. He observed the value of Indian culture and the golden teaching of the Sanatan Dharma that can change human being and uplift their platform of life.

The heritage which develops emotionally through centuries is leading to a scieitific analytical force. The Oriental Scholars and Hermits through persistent meditation have reached to the conclusion that every worldly affairs is endowed with for characteristics – Dharma, Karma, Prema and Gyana.

First of all Dharma means nature. Everything has definite nature, whether living or otherwise. A monkey has a distinct nature while a human being has a nature of his own. Similarly metals have their own nature. Secondly, alongwith the characteristics of nature, there is a certain activity that is attributed to , or that comes out of, every object. This activity is Karma.
